Output 7f515e06c7f33842883be95e8ef4b40679ec43486523e7d534c7a604a5eb3a7d:0

value
5905352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ad824d919de18fc88eb52e55c7665139d606bd OP_EQUAL
address
M8RBU1HZMKJGgVh91FPWsJaEHM61ozoAjp
transaction
7f515e06c7f33842883be95e8ef4b40679ec43486523e7d534c7a604a5eb3a7d
spent
true